本机受限,虚拟机软件下载需另辟蹊径
本机无法复制粘贴到虚拟机下载软件

首页 2024-06-27 09:46:03



本机与虚拟机间软件传输的专业实践 在信息技术领域,特别是在软件开发和测试环境中,经常需要在物理主机(本机)与虚拟机之间进行数据传输,其中包括软件的复制和安装

    然而,由于安全、性能以及系统兼容性的考虑,直接通过复制粘贴方式在本机与虚拟机之间传输软件可能并不总是可行的或推荐的做法

    本文旨在探讨如何在确保安全性和效率的前提下,实现本机与虚拟机之间的软件传输

     一、理解限制与风险 在尝试将软件从本机复制到虚拟机时,首先需要理解可能存在的限制和风险

    这些限制可能来自操作系统的安全策略、虚拟化软件的限制,或是软件本身的授权和兼容性要求

    此外,直接复制粘贴软件文件可能导致文件损坏、病毒感染或系统不稳定等问题

     二、选择合适的传输方式 为了安全有效地传输软件,可以选择以下几种方式: 1. 网络共享:通过在本机和虚拟机之间设置网络共享(如SMB、NFS等),可以方便地在两个系统之间传输文件

    这种方法安全且可靠,同时支持大文件传输

     2. FTP/SFTP服务器:在本机上搭建FTP或SFTP服务器,并在虚拟机中使用FTP/SFTP客户端进行连接和文件传输

    这种方式适用于需要跨网络进行文件传输的场景

     3. 使用USB设备:如果物理条件允许,可以将软件安装文件复制到USB设备中,然后将其插入到虚拟机所在的物理主机上,并在虚拟机中访问USB设备以获取文件

     4. 使用虚拟化软件的功能:一些虚拟化软件(如VMware、VirtualBox等)提供了从主机到虚拟机的文件传输功能,如VMware的“Drag and Drop”功能或VirtualBox的“Shared Folders”功能

     三、实践步骤 以使用网络共享为例,以下是实现本机与虚拟机之间软件传输的具体步骤: 1. 设置网络共享:在本机上选择一个文件夹,设置其共享属性,并为其分配一个网络共享名

     2. 配置虚拟机网络:确保虚拟机已连接到与本机相同的网络,并能够访问本机的网络共享

     3. 在虚拟机中访问共享:在虚拟机中打开文件管理器,并导航到“网络”或“网络位置”区域,找到并连接到本机的网络共享

     4. 复制软件文件:将需要传输的软件文件从本机的网络共享复制到虚拟机的目标位置

     5. 安装和运行软件:在虚拟机中导航到软件文件所在的位置,并按照软件的安装说明进行安装和运行

     四、安全注意事项 在进行文件传输时,务必注意以下几点以确保安全性: 1. 验证文件完整性:在传输前和传输后,使用校验和工具验证文件的完整性,以确保文件在传输过程中未被篡改

     2. 使用加密传输:如果可能的话,使用FTPS、SFTP等加密协议进行文件传输,以防止数据在传输过程中被截获

     3. 限制访问权限:确保只有授权的用户能够访问网络共享或FTP/SFTP服务器上的文件

     4. 及时更新和打补丁:定期更新操作系统、虚拟化软件和防病毒软件,以应对新的安全威胁

     综上所述,虽然直接通过复制粘贴方式在本机与虚拟机之间传输软件可能方便快捷,但考虑到安全性和效率问题,建议选择更为可靠和安全的传输方式

    通过遵循上述步骤和注意事项,可以确保在维护系统稳定性的同时,高效地完成软件传输任务